About The Position

The Trane Company Position Advanced Manufacturing Engineer New Product Development (AME-NPD) Project Lead will drive transformational change and design New Product Line through 3P Lean and Six Sigma tools. The role involves leading and driving lean transformation by eliminating waste and increasing the velocity of customer orders. It requires being a quick learner of new processes, products, and lean methodologies, documenting normal states, and identifying actions to correct abnormal conditions. The position utilizes Design, Six Sigma, and Lean Manufacturing tools to identify cost savings opportunities and conduct feasibility studies. It involves working with 3P Manufacturing Engineers, Design Leaders, and Engineering Leaders to prioritize projects, and collaborating with the 3P design team, Engineering team, and Plant Hourly Associates to improve measurements, analysis, development, and implementation of tools such as gap analysis, process performance, standard work, and cycle time reduction. Additionally, the role involves developing, measuring, and reporting on safety and quality criteria of New Product Design, and assisting other manufacturing team members with project completion.
